    Southern Illinois University Edwardsville School of Engineering is an academic unit of Southern Illinois University Edwardsville located in Edwardsville, Illinois, United States. [1] The school enrolls more than 1,450 undergraduates and over 250 graduate students.

    The Engineering Building, opened in 2000 and expanded in 2013–14, houses the SIUE School of Engineering. It includes classrooms, laboratories, and offices for the school and its departments.     It is home to the SIU Edwardsville Cougars baseball team of the NCAA Division I Ohio Valley Conference. [2] The facility, which has a capacity of 1,500 spectators, is named for SIUE's first baseball coach, Roy E. Lee. [3] The distance to the fences is 330 feet to right and left fields and 390 to center. [4]

    The Sam M. Vadalabene Center is a multi-purpose sports and recreation building on the campus of Southern Illinois University Edwardsville (SIUE) that features an arena (known as "First Community Arena" for sponsorship reasons) with a seating capacity of just over 4,000.
